Maxwell Park Eviction Risk: Elevated

4 census tracts · pop 17,734 · pop-weighted Eviction Risk Score 6.7/10 · range 5.8–7.4

Maxwell Park is a hispanic-white neighborhood in Oakland with 4 census tracts and a population of 17,734 residents. The neighborhood's pop-weighted eviction-risk score of 6.7/10 (Elevated tier) blends state law, county-level fil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ty. 56% of renters here pay at least 30% of household income on rent, and 28% are severely cost-burdened (≥50% of income). Average gross rent of $1,922/month sits 3% lower than the Oakland citywide average ($1,979).

Frequently asked

About Maxwell Park

Q1

What is the eviction-risk score for Maxwell Park?

Maxwell Park scores 6.7/10 (Elevated tier) across 4 census tracts. The pop-weighted Eviction Risk Score blends state law, county fil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income and poverty signals.
Q2

How does Maxwell Park compare to Oakland overall?

Maxwell Park scores 3.2 points lower than Oakland overall (9.9/10). Renters spend 56% of income on rent vs 31% citywide. Average rent: $1,922 vs $1,979.
Q3

What is the average rent in Maxwell Park?

Average gross rent in Maxwell Park is $1,922/month (pop-weighted across 4 census tracts, ACS 5-year 2023). 56% of renter households are cost-burdened.
Q4

What percentage of Maxwell Park residents are renters?

39% of Maxwell Park households are renter-occupied (vs 58% in Oakland). The neighborhood has 17,734 residents.
Q5

Is Maxwell Park a high social-vulnerability area?

Maxwell Park sits in the 67th percentile nationally on the CDC Social Vulnerability Index (moderately vulnerable). The index combines poverty, unemployment, household composition, racial/ethnic minority share, and housing/transportation factors across all US census tracts.
Q6

Which tracts in Maxwell Park have the highest eviction risk?

The highest-risk constituent tract in Maxwell Park is census tract 06001407102 (score 7.4/10). Across the 4 tracts in this neighborhood the score ranges from 5.8 to 7.4, a spread of 1.6 points.
Q7

How safe is Maxwell Park for landlords?

Maxwell Park carries a elevated-tier eviction-risk profile for landlords (6.7/10). Pop-weighted across 4 constituent tracts, the score blends parent-city rent-control posture, county eviction-process timelines, and tract-specific rent-to-income / poverty signals. Compared to Oakland as a whole (9.9/10), this neighborhood is lower-risk.
Q8

What is the demographic breakdown of Maxwell Park?

Maxwell Park has 18,228 residents (Hispanic-White Neighborhood). Top groups: Hispanic / Latino (32.8%), White (non-Hispanic) (26%), Black (non-Hispanic) (20.7%). Source: ACS 5-year 2023, table B03002.
